Roanoke Valley law enforcement reported the following:

Northampton County Sheriff’s Office

Captain Patrick Jacobs reported on Monday around 12:30 a.m. the sheriff’s office responded to Mills Street in Severn on a call concerning a person who had been shot.

Deputies discovered that 51-year-old Erskine Lawrence of Severn had sustained gunshot wounds to the body resulting in his death on scene. 

Jacobs said investigation continues and anyone with information is encouraged to contact the sheriff’s office at 252-534-2611 or Crime Stoppers at 252-534-1110.

Weldon Police Department

Chief Christopher Davis reported on Thursday around 10:30 p.m. Sergeant L. Melton responded to Rockfish Drive about the larceny of a wallet.

The victim said while they were cleaning someone later identified as Willie Thomas Suiter III came into the building and took the wallet.

Melton reviewed security footage and got an image of the alleged suspect. 

Later that evening during his patrol on West First Street, Melton located Suiter, 43, of Weldon.

Suiter was placed under arrest and taken before a Halifax County Magistrate. 

He was charged with misdemeanor larceny and received a $1,000 unsecured bond. He has a July 12 court date.

Corporal S. McKimmey assisted. 

On Monday around 8:30 p.m. Officer M. DiPietro was patrolling in the 400 block of Sycamore Street when she came across a domestic in progress. 

The officer activated emergency lights and got out of her patrol vehicle. The officer gave commands to the man who was striking the female victim. 

The man, later identified as Detavioun Denoris Ingram, 37, of Port St. Lucie, Florida, complied.

DiPetro requested assistance from the Halifax County Sheriff's Office and a deputy arrived.

He was transported to the Halifax County Magistrate’s Office where he kept trying to snatch away from the officer while being escorted.

He was charged with assault on a female and resisting a public officer. He was jailed without opportunity for bond due to the domestic nature of the case. He has a July 6 court date.
